Key Technology introduces sanitary rotary finish on vibratory conveyors

Tuesday, 05 August, 2014 | Supplied by: Key Technology Australia Pty Ltd


Key Technology has introduced a rotary polish as the standard finish on its vibratory and horizontal motion conveyor beds. Replacing the 2B mill finish on Iso-Flo, Impulse, and Horizon conveyors and processing systems, the rotary finish provides a smoother stainless steel surface that resists bacterial attachment and biofilm formation.

Compared to a 2B finish on stainless steel that often varies from 0.254 to 1.016 µm Ra, the rotary finish provides a more constant Ra value of less than 0.254 µm. The finish is suitable for all food products including fruits, vegetables, potato products, snacks, nuts, meat and dairy.

The conveyors also feature ground and polished welds within the product contact zone and ground and polished surfaces within the ‘drip, drain or draw zones’ where there is a risk the product area could become contaminated.
